Enable CORS on Google cloud storage
~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~

If you have track files hotsed in Google cloud storage, they can be viewed in the browser as well after setting up correct CORS policy.

First you need make the bucket public, for more information you can check the `docs from google <https://cloud.google.com/storage/docs/access-control/making-data-public>`_:

.. image:: _static/gs1.png

Then you can use either the `gsutl <https://cloud.google.com/storage/docs/quickstart-gsutil?cloudshell=true>`_ or the CloudShell in your Google cloud's web console. Create a file called ``cors.json`` with contents below::

[
{
"origin": ["*"],
"method": ["GET", "HEAD"],
"responseHeader": ["Authorization", "Content-Range", "Accept", "Content-Type", "Origin", "Range"],
"maxAgeSeconds": 3600
}
]

then set the CORS policy to your bucket with the command below::

gsutil cors set cors.json gs://washu-browser-track-host

the screenshot below shows how I did in CloudShell in the console web page:

.. image:: _static/gs2.png

After this, you can copy the URL to the file and submit to the browser for visualization.
